This particular Periquita, crafted by the esteemed José Maria da Fonseca, is a testament to their dedication to quality and innovation, a legacy that spans over a century.

Crafted from the Castelão grape, a variety that thrives in the sandy soils of the region, this Periquita unfolds with a symphony of flavors. Imagine yourself strolling through a Portuguese orchard, the air filled with the aroma of ripe red fruits – cherries, raspberries, and a hint of plum. This is the essence of Periquita. The palate is greeted with a delightful interplay of fruit, a subtle spiciness that adds complexity, and a touch of earthiness that grounds the wine, reflecting its terroir. It's a dry wine, meaning the sugars have been fully fermented, resulting in a clean, crisp finish that leaves you wanting more.

But what truly sets Periquita apart is its versatility. It's a wine that doesn't demand attention but gracefully complements a wide range of dishes. Picture this: you're hosting a cozy dinner party. The aroma of roasted chicken fills the air, mingling with the anticipation of good company. Periquita is the perfect companion, its fruit-forward character enhancing the savory notes of the chicken, its subtle tannins cutting through the richness. Or perhaps you're in the mood for something more casual. A platter of grilled sausages, chorizo, and peppers, served with crusty bread and aioli. Periquita shines here too, its earthy notes complementing the smoky flavors of the grill.

Don't underestimate its ability to pair with vegetarian dishes either. A hearty lentil stew, seasoned with herbs and spices, finds a perfect match in Periquita's robust character. Even a simple plate of mature cheeses, like Manchego or Serra da Estrela, is elevated by the wine's fruity and spicy notes.

Serve this Periquita slightly chilled, around 16°C, to fully appreciate its aromas and flavors. There's no need to decant it; its approachable style is ready to be enjoyed straight from the bottle.
